Troubleshooting GNU Cash Reconciliation Balancing Errors
Introduction
As a new GNU Cash user, encountering reconciliation balancing errors can be a frustrating experience. GNU Cash, a powerful open-source accounting software, offers robust features for managing personal and small business finances. Reconciliation, the process of matching your bank statements with your ledger entries, is crucial for ensuring accuracy. This article delves into the common causes of reconciliation balancing errors in GNU Cash, particularly those arising from auto-entries, and provides step-by-step solutions to rectify these issues. We'll explore how to identify the root cause of the "Balancing entry from..." message and guide you through the process of correcting your ledger. Understanding the intricacies of GNU Cash reconciliation is key to maintaining accurate financial records and leveraging the full potential of this software.
Understanding GNU Cash Reconciliation
Before diving into error resolution, it's essential to grasp the core concept of reconciliation in GNU Cash. Reconciliation is the process of comparing your bank statements with your ledger entries in GNU Cash to ensure that all transactions are accounted for and that your balances match. This process helps identify discrepancies such as missing transactions, incorrect amounts, or duplicate entries. The goal is to bring your GNU Cash ledger into perfect alignment with your bank's records, providing a clear and accurate picture of your financial standing. Reconciliation in GNU Cash involves marking transactions as cleared or reconciled, indicating that they have been verified against your bank statement. This process is crucial for maintaining the integrity of your financial data and ensuring that your reports accurately reflect your financial position. When discrepancies arise, GNU Cash may create automatic balancing entries to force the ledger into balance. However, these entries often signal underlying issues that need to be addressed, which is why understanding how to handle them is critical for effective financial management. The reconciliation process in GNU Cash not only helps in identifying errors but also provides a strong foundation for financial analysis and decision-making. By ensuring that your records are accurate and up-to-date, you can make informed choices about your spending, saving, and investments. Regular reconciliation is a cornerstone of good financial practice, and mastering this process in GNU Cash will significantly enhance your financial management capabilities.
Common Causes of Balancing Errors During Reconciliation
Several factors can contribute to balancing errors during reconciliation in GNU Cash. One common cause is incorrectly cleared transactions. If you accidentally clear a transaction that doesn't appear on your bank statement or fail to clear one that does, it can lead to a discrepancy. Another frequent issue is missing transactions. Transactions that haven't been entered into your ledger but appear on your bank statement, or vice versa, will cause an imbalance. Data entry errors, such as incorrect amounts or dates, are also a significant source of reconciliation problems. These errors can be subtle and easily overlooked, but they can have a substantial impact on your balances. The timing of transactions can also be a factor. Transactions that occur close to the end of a statement period may not appear on the current statement, leading to temporary discrepancies. Furthermore, unaccounted for fees or charges, such as bank fees or interest payments, can throw off your reconciliation if they haven't been recorded in your ledger. Automatic transactions, such as recurring payments or transfers, can also cause confusion if they are not properly tracked or if there are discrepancies in the amounts or dates. Finally, errors in previous reconciliation periods can carry over and compound the problem, making it essential to address errors promptly. Understanding these common causes of balancing errors is the first step in effectively troubleshooting and resolving reconciliation issues in GNU Cash. By identifying the potential sources of errors, you can approach the reconciliation process more systematically and ensure the accuracy of your financial records.
Decoding the "Balancing Entry From..." Message
When you encounter a "Balancing entry from..." message in GNU Cash, it indicates that the software has automatically created an entry to force your ledger into balance. This typically happens when the reconciliation process detects a discrepancy between your GNU Cash ledger and your bank statement. While these balancing entries can temporarily resolve the imbalance, they often mask underlying problems that need to be addressed. The message itself usually includes information about the source of the balancing entry, such as the account and date. This information can be crucial in tracking down the root cause of the error. It's important to view these balancing entries as a symptom of a problem rather than a solution. Simply accepting the balancing entry without investigating the cause can lead to further inaccuracies in your financial records. The "Balancing entry from..." message serves as a red flag, prompting you to carefully review your transactions and reconciliation process. To effectively decode this message, you need to analyze the context in which it appeared. Consider the transactions you were reconciling, the dates involved, and any unusual activity in your accounts. By thoroughly examining the circumstances surrounding the balancing entry, you can pinpoint the source of the discrepancy and take corrective action. This might involve correcting data entry errors, adding missing transactions, or adjusting previously reconciled entries. Ultimately, understanding the meaning behind the "Balancing entry from..." message is a vital step in maintaining accurate and reliable financial records in GNU Cash.
Step-by-Step Guide to Fixing Balancing Errors
Resolving balancing errors in GNU Cash requires a systematic approach. Here’s a step-by-step guide to help you identify and fix these issues:
- Review the Balancing Entry: Start by examining the "Balancing entry from..." message in detail. Note the date, account, and amount of the entry. This information provides valuable clues about where the discrepancy might be.
- Unreconcile and Reconcile: If you recently completed a reconciliation, try unreconciling the account and starting the process again. This can help identify any errors made during the initial reconciliation. To unreconcile, go to the account register, select the account, and then go to Actions > Reconcile. Click the "Unreconcile" button and then start reconcile process again.
- Compare Transactions: Carefully compare your GNU Cash ledger with your bank statement. Look for missing transactions, incorrect amounts, or duplicate entries. Pay close attention to transactions around the date of the balancing entry.
- Check Cleared Status: Verify that all transactions marked as cleared in GNU Cash appear on your bank statement, and vice versa. Incorrectly cleared transactions are a common cause of balancing errors.
- Look for Data Entry Errors: Scrutinize your entries for typos, incorrect dates, or transposed numbers. Even small errors can lead to significant imbalances.
- Consider Timing Differences: Be mindful of transactions that may have occurred close to the end of the statement period. These transactions might not appear on the current statement and could cause a temporary discrepancy.
- Review Previous Reconciliations: If the error persists, examine your previous reconciliation reports. Errors in past reconciliations can carry over and affect current balances.
- Account for Fees and Charges: Ensure that all bank fees, interest payments, and other charges are recorded in your ledger. These often-overlooked items can throw off your balance.
- Use Reports: GNU Cash reports can help you identify discrepancies. Generate a transaction report for the affected account and time period to compare against your bank statement.
- Consult Online Resources: If you're still stuck, consult the GNU Cash documentation, online forums, or community support groups. Other users may have encountered similar issues and can offer helpful advice.
By following these steps, you can systematically identify and correct balancing errors in GNU Cash, ensuring the accuracy of your financial records. Remember, patience and attention to detail are key to successful reconciliation.
Advanced Troubleshooting Techniques
When basic troubleshooting steps don't resolve the balancing error, advanced techniques can help uncover more elusive issues in GNU Cash. One such technique involves examining the transaction journal, a detailed record of all financial transactions in your GNU Cash data file. By reviewing the journal, you can identify any unusual or unexpected entries that might be contributing to the imbalance. Another useful approach is to split transactions to ensure that each part is correctly categorized and reconciled. Sometimes, a single transaction that is incorrectly split can lead to reconciliation problems. You should also pay close attention to currency conversions, especially if you're dealing with multiple currencies in your GNU Cash setup. Incorrect conversion rates or misapplied currencies can cause significant discrepancies. Complex financial transactions, such as investments or loans, often require careful handling during reconciliation. Make sure that all aspects of these transactions, including interest, fees, and principal payments, are accurately recorded. If you suspect that the problem might be related to a specific transaction, try deleting and re-entering it. This can sometimes resolve underlying data corruption issues. In rare cases, the balancing error might be caused by a software glitch or a corrupted data file. If you've exhausted all other troubleshooting steps, consider backing up your data file and trying to restore it to a previous version. You might also want to consult the GNU Cash bug tracker or community forums to see if others have reported similar issues. Finally, if you're comfortable with database management, you can use a tool like SQL to directly query your GNU Cash data file and look for inconsistencies. However, this should only be attempted by experienced users, as incorrect modifications to the database can cause data loss. By employing these advanced troubleshooting techniques, you can tackle even the most challenging balancing errors in GNU Cash and maintain the integrity of your financial data.
Preventing Future Reconciliation Errors
Preventing reconciliation errors in GNU Cash is crucial for maintaining accurate financial records and saving time in the long run. One of the most effective preventative measures is to establish a regular reconciliation schedule. Reconciling your accounts frequently, such as weekly or monthly, allows you to catch errors early before they snowball into larger problems. Accurate data entry is another key factor in preventing errors. Double-check all transactions as you enter them, paying close attention to dates, amounts, and categories. Using memorized transactions for recurring payments and deposits can reduce the risk of data entry mistakes. It's also important to document your reconciliation process. Keep a record of each reconciliation, including the date, any discrepancies found, and the steps taken to resolve them. This documentation can be invaluable for tracking down past errors and identifying patterns. Regularly backing up your GNU Cash data file is essential for protecting your financial information. If you encounter a data corruption issue or make a mistake that's difficult to undo, you can restore your data from a recent backup. Staying up-to-date with the latest version of GNU Cash is also important. Software updates often include bug fixes and improvements that can help prevent errors. Educate yourself about GNU Cash features and best practices. The more you understand the software, the less likely you are to make mistakes. Utilize GNU Cash's built-in error-checking tools to identify potential problems. For example, the software can flag duplicate transactions or transactions that don't balance. Finally, seek help when needed. If you're unsure about a particular transaction or reconciliation step, don't hesitate to consult the GNU Cash documentation, online forums, or community support groups. By implementing these preventative measures, you can minimize the risk of reconciliation errors and ensure the accuracy of your financial records in GNU Cash.
Conclusion
Reconciliation balancing errors in GNU Cash, particularly those indicated by the "Balancing entry from..." message, can be a significant concern for users striving for accurate financial management. However, by understanding the common causes of these errors and following a systematic troubleshooting approach, you can effectively resolve these issues and maintain the integrity of your financial data. This comprehensive guide has provided a step-by-step methodology for identifying and correcting balancing errors, along with advanced techniques for tackling more complex problems. Moreover, it has emphasized the importance of preventative measures, such as regular reconciliation, accurate data entry, and staying informed about GNU Cash best practices. By adopting these strategies, you can minimize the occurrence of reconciliation errors and ensure the reliability of your financial records. GNU Cash is a powerful tool for managing personal and small business finances, and mastering the reconciliation process is essential for leveraging its full potential. With patience, attention to detail, and a methodical approach, you can confidently navigate the reconciliation process and gain a clear and accurate understanding of your financial position. Remember, the "Balancing entry from..." message is not an end-point but a starting point for investigation and correction, ultimately leading to more robust and reliable financial management within GNU Cash.